Detailed Comparison

MetricFinance officersMedia ProfessionalsDifference
Median Annual£29,252£41,593-£12,341
Mean Annual£29,539£45,271-£15,732
Monthly£2,438£3,466-£1,028
Weekly£563£800-£237
Hourly£14.06£20.00-£5.94

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ileFinance officersMedia Professionals
10th (Entry)£15,237£24,942
25th£23,747£31,997
50th (Median)£29,252£41,593
75th£35,822£53,203
